Republic of the Philippines

DEPARTMENT OF TRANSPORTATION AND COMMUNICATIONS

LIGHT RAIL TRANSIT LINE 6 PROJECT

INSTRUCTIONS TO PROSPECTIVE BIDDERS (“ITPB”)

INTRODUCTION 1. The Department of Transportation and Communications (“DOTC”) invites Prospective

Bidders to apply to pre-qualify and bid to finance, design, construct, operate and maintain the Light Rail Transit (“LRT”) Line 6 pursuant to a two-stage public bidding process in accordance with the BOT Law and its Revised IRR, the applicable provisions of which are deemed incorporated herein by reference. The LRT Line 6 Project (the “Project”) consists of:

(a) Design, procurement, engineering, construction, installation, completion,

testing and commissioning of the Project infrastructure and facilities, which will include:

(i) railway infrastructure component with a 19-kilometer elevated rail line

in the Province of Cavite, from Niyog, Bacoor City to Dasmariňas City, having seven (7) stations,) namely: (1) Niyog (transfer between LRT Line 6 and LRT Line 1 Cavite Extension project (“LRT1 CAVEX”)), (2) Tirona, (3) Imus, (4) Daang Hari, (5) Salitran, (6) Congressional Avenue and (7) Governor’s Drive and other related assets including the depot (“Railway Infrastructure”);

(ii) railway systems component which includes provisions for train control

and signaling system, traction power supply distribution system, power substations and telecommunications system (“Railway Systems”); and

(iii) rolling stock (“Rolling Stock”), which shall conform to the

specifications to be set out in the minimum performance standards and specifications that will form part of the Concession Agreement;

(b) Operation and maintenance of the LRT Line 6 system composed of the depot,

the Railway Infrastructure, the Railway Systems, Rolling Stock and other related assets (“LRT Line 6 System”);

(c) System enhancement works covering whole-of-life investments for the LRT

Line 6 System, which include fleet upgrades (replacements and refurbishments), periodic rehabilitation/restoration works, any required depot expansion works to accommodate outstanding train fleet and all other investments needed to ensure sustained levels of services in accordance with the minimum performance standards and specifications to be set out in the Concession Agreement; and

(d) Provision of a pedestrian connection between the LRT Line 6 station at Niyog

and the LRT1 CAVEX project station at Niyog to provide users of each system with access to the system of the other.

The Project Information Memorandum describes the Project and its indicative contract terms.

Section 2 THE BIDDING PROCESS 2.1 PBAC and Advisors 2.1.1 Role of the PBAC The PBAC for the Project created by the DOTC Special Order No. 2015-500 (issued on 27 November 2015) and the amendments thereto shall be responsible for all aspects of the Bidding Process for the Project, including the interpretation of the rules regarding the Bidding. 2.1.2 Role of Transaction Advisors

A consortium of advisors led by Ernst & Young Solutions LLP (“EY”) as transaction advisor and CPCS Transcom Limited (“CPCS”) as technical advisor (“Transaction Advisors”) has been appointed to assist the DOTC in the structuring and tendering of the Project. Transaction Advisors will assist the DOTC in undertaking and ensuring a fair, transparent and competitive selection process that will mobilize private sector participation in the implementation of the Project. The assistance of the Transaction Advisors covers all Project pre-investment activities including due diligence review, transaction structuring, marketing and promotion, contract preparation, and support to the DOTC in the development of bid documents, conduct of the Bidding, evaluation of the Bid Proposals and the award of the Project to the Winning Bidder. Supporting the Transaction Advisors in its advisory work is a team of international technical and legal service firms and local legal consultants.

3.2.5 Rolling Stock Experience (a) The Prospective Bidder or a related entity, as described below, must have Philippine or

international experience in successfully manufacturing and delivering rolling stock (the “Rolling Stock Experience”).

(b) The RS Nominee must have been in existence for at least ten (10) consecutive years,

prior to the Pre-qualification Documents Submission Date and should have manufactured and delivered at least one hundred (100) passenger rail cars in the last ten (10) years prior to the Pre-qualification Documents Submission Date, of which at least fifty (50) cars should have been delivered and commissioned in the last five (5) years prior to the Pre-qualification Documents Submission Date. The specified number of rail cars need not have been from a single project or contract.

3.2.6 Operations and Maintenance Experience (a) The Prospective Bidder or a related entity, as described below, must have Philippine or

international experience in all of the following:

(i) Operation of a metropolitan passenger rail transit system which is capable of transporting at least twenty five (25) million passengers and has actually transported at least fifteen (15) million passengers per fiscal year for a period of at least three (3) full consecutive fiscal years within the last five (5) years prior to the Pre-qualification Documents Submission Date;

(ii) Maintenance of a metropolitan passenger rail transit system which has achieved

a minimum of one (1) million train kilometers per fiscal year for a period of at least three (3) full consecutive fiscal years within the last five (5) years prior to the Pre-qualification Documents Submission Date, provided that if it can be

Page 35: LRT Line 6 Project - PPP Center · or any other person. The purpose of the Invitation Documents is to provide interested parties with information that may be useful to them for the

INSTRUCTIONS TO PROSPECTIVE BIDDERS

Page 34 of 116

proven that the entity proposed to meet the O&M Experience was fully responsible for the maintenance of a metropolitan passenger rail transit system meeting the specifications prescribed in this paragraph, even if it was not directly performing the maintenance itself, such entity shall be deemed to possess the maintenance experience required under this paragraph; and

(iii) Management of or active participation in the commissioning process for a

metropolitan passenger rail transit system which is capable of transporting at least twenty five (25) million passengers and has actually transported at least fifteen (15) million passengers per fiscal year, for a period of at least three (3) full consecutive fiscal years or a section of such system, within the last fifteen (15) years prior to the Pre-qualification Documents Submission Date.

(b) The experience enumerated in the preceding paragraph (a) may be fulfilled by a single

Reference Project. Alternatively, one (1) Reference Project may be proposed to meet the O&M Experience required in paragraphs (a)(i) and (a)(ii) above respectively, and another Reference Project may be proposed to meet the commissioning experience required under paragraph (a)(iii).

3.3 Financial Capability Qualification Requirements (a) To qualify to bid for the Project, the Prospective Bidder or a related entity, as described

below, must meet the following Financial Capability Requirements:

(i) have a net worth of at least Twelve Billion Philippine Pesos (PhP 12,000,000,000.00) or its equivalent as of its latest Audited Financial Statements, which must be dated not earlier than 31 December 2014; and

(ii) provide evidence that it has the capability to raise loans of at least Twenty Billion

Philippine Pesos (PhP 20,000,000,000.00) for the Project. (b) The entity which fulfills this requirement must be:
